A Different Saturday


After almost a year of Saturday classes at Cavite Computer Center (CCC),  I am able to finish five out of seven modules of my basic computer study, and yesterday was our recognition day, it was the 17th for the Center. It was held at the Capitol's Gymnasium at Trece Martirez City. We (me, my nephew and his cousin) arrived at the venue at around 12:30 p.m. Can you imagine how hot it is outside walking at that time of the day wearing a semi-formal dress? If you personally knew me you know I'm not used to wearing that kind of stuff, but I sure can if the situation calls for it. For everyone's peace of mind or shall I say sanity LOL, I'm wearing a white blouse (imagine that), a black pants and a black doll shoes. Sorry guys, but you have to picture this out in your mind since I'm not sure if I can provide a picture. Unintentionally, I forgot to recharge my digital camera yesterday! Sometimes, my stupidity really knocks on me.
While waiting for the guests, intermission numbers are presented, a student from CCC sings her own rendition of Celine Dion's That's The Way It Is; a performer (I forgot his name) with his comedy act and his version of Don't Cry Joni; and a very touchy performance by the choir of Children's Joy Foundation. Raffles are drawn in between, prizes were three pieces of 100 worth of cell cards each for smart, globe and sun subscribers, five Smart Plug-It and three brand new cellphones courtesy of Smart Telecom. Also, a free snack was served, ham and egg sandwich with juice for both the graduates and guests as well. Mind you guys, the gymnasium is air-conditioned and the temperature is good enough for me  (maybe a little cold for others). 
The center must have put a lot of effort for this event considering also the budget, since we don't pay for anything, just our transportation fee and P20 for two pieces of ticket, which is not compulsory. Not bad, considering the effort of the staff to prepare everything.
At 3:00 p.m., the program starts when the guests led by Gov. Ayong Maliksi finally arrived. After the opening prayer, National Anthem and Cavite Hymn and inspirational talks from the guests, the commencement of 1000 students starts. Issuance of certificates and the raffle of three mobile phones sponsored by Smart closed the event at past 6 in the evening.
